XYO Network is the world's first blockchain-based, people-centric location verification network. This technology will drive the future of the world. As the running fuel of XYO Network, we call it XYO. The XYO Network has been working to allow developers, such as those writing smart contracts for blockchain platforms, to interact with the physical world in an API-like manner. The XYO Network is the world's first oracle protocol that enables real-world transactions between two entities without a centralized third party. Our virtual network allows developers to perform location verification in a trustless manner, creating a new protocol with promising future applications.
The XYO Network will build on the existing infrastructure of over 1,000,000 devices in global circulation across our consumer-facing pan-connected business channels. XY's Bluetooth and GPS devices allow everyday consumers to place physical tracking beacons on things they want to track (like keys, luggage, bikes and even pets). If they misplace or lose such an item, they can see its exact location through a smartphone app. In just six years, XYO Networks has created the world's largest consumer Bluetooth and GPS network.
The XYO network consists of four main components: sentinel nodes (data collectors), bridge nodes (data relayers), archive nodes (data storage) and oracle nodes (answer aggregators). Sentinel nodes collect location information through sensors, radio, and other means. Bridge nodes are responsible for fetching this data from sentinel nodes and providing it to archive nodes. Archive nodes are responsible for storing this information for analysis by oracle nodes. Oracle nodes are responsible for analyzing the heuristic location data provided by archive nodes in order to generate query answers and assign them accuracy scores. The oracle node then feeds these answers back to the smart contract (thus, the oracle node acts as an oracle). The accuracy score, or chain of origin score, is determined through a series of zero-knowledge proofs known as a proof-of-origin chain. The chain guarantees that two or more pieces of data come from the same source without revealing any underlying information. Each component in the query path generates its own proof of origin, which is then linked to each component the data arrives at. Proof of Origin is a novel formulation that builds a chain of cryptographic proofs along the path of relayers in the network to provide highly trusted real-world data. This proof-of-origin chain encapsulates our confidence in a piece of location data into the first devices that collected it. We will explore how Proof of Origin works in the following sections.
In order to establish a decentralized consensus mechanism among oracle nodes, the XYO network will rely on a public, immutable blockchain—XYOMainChain, which will store query transactions and data collected from oracle nodes and its associated source score. Before we dive into the functional details of the overall system, we will clearly define the responsibilities of each component in the network.
Sentinels – Heuristic Witnesses
They will observe and vouch for the certainty and accuracy of the heuristic by generating temporal classifications. The most important aspect of Sentinel is that it generates ledgers where Diviners can prove origin from the same source by adding a country of origin to them.
Bridges – Heuristic Transcribers
They securely pass heuristic ledgers from Sentinels to Diviners. The most important aspect of the Bridge is that the Diviner can ensure that the heuristic ledger received from the Bridge has not been altered in any way. The second most important aspect of bridges is that they add an additional certificate of origin.
Archivist
The Archivist component stores heuristics in a decentralized form, the goal is to store all historical ledgers, but there is no requirement for that. Even if some data is lost or temporarily unavailable, the system will continue to function, but with reduced accuracy. Archivists also index ledgers so they can return a range of ledger data as needed. Archivists only store raw data and are paid only to retrieve it. Storage is always free.
Diviners
A Diviner answers a given question by analyzing historical data stored by the XYO network. In order to achieve this, the heuristics stored in the XYO Network must have a high level of Proof of Origin to measure the effectiveness and accuracy of the heuristics by judging witnesses based on their Proof of Origin. Given that the XYO Network is a trustless system, Diviners must be incentivized to provide heuristic honest analysis. Unlike Sentinels and Bridges, Diviners use proof of work to add answers to the blockchain.
Airports
One of the biggest concerns for airline travelers is lost or stolen luggage. Counting all bags passing through TSA checkpoints, gates and aircraft is important not only to travelers, but to the overall safety and security of the entire airport. XYO Network can provide independently verified location data that can help minimize mishandled baggage and ultimately save travelers and airport staff time and money spent tracking down lost bags.
Hospital
From medical equipment to the identification of patients and staff, one misplacement or mistake can mean the difference between life and death. XYO Network can provide error-free, verified location reporting, which is critical in such a sensitive environment. With the unique blockchain technology of XYO Network, it is possible for hospitals to reduce errors and improve efficiency. The implications could reduce prescribing dosing errors, prevent unnecessary procedures, and ultimately save lives.
E-Commerce
The XYO Network rewards nodes within the network with XYO tokens to incentivize them to report location and file accounts. For example, when a last-mile courier like a UPS driver encounters an XYO Network node on its route, that node will record its XYO Network ledger for archiving. Leveraging cryptoeconomics in this way exploits a key feature of blockchain technology — that it is a trustless, decentralized system. This means it can provide third-party verification and a level of reliability that current tracking systems simply cannot provide.
Insurance
From cell phones to sports cars, owned assets that are constantly on the move are prime candidates for loss and theft protection insurance. The XYO Network can report the location of insured items by providing independently verified and trustless location data. Being able to recover an item reported as lost or stolen provides satisfaction to the insured party, while the ability to locate the item in the event of a false claim protects the insurer from fraud. Thus, XYO Network's decentralized blockchain technology enables both insurers and insureds to have access to the same verification data and ultimately creates unprecedented accountability for both parties.
National Security
The presence of government-regulated firearms in locations where weapons are strictly prohibited inherently presents considerable risk. Tight security controls are imperative at major transportation hubs (i.e. international airports) where traffic volumes are high and potential hazards are inherently obvious. The "XYO Network" can confirm the exact location of a weapon by reporting independently verified trustless location data. Through its decentralized blockchain technology, the XYO Network is able to provide an unrivaled element of security and accountability to arguably the most purposeful and riskiest institutions in the world.
Rental Cars
There are many businesses that derive their primary source of income from the rental of goods. To reduce the replacement cost of lost or stolen items, it is especially important to be able to track the location of rental items. XYO Network can provide independently verified location data that helps minimize cargo loss, ultimately saving the rental industry millions of dollars annually. The incorporation of XYO Network's unique blockchain technology also increases the overall efficiency of rental companies as less time is spent on lost procedures.
Drones
Where will drones fly? How to prevent accidents from happening? How to confirm package delivery? The XYO Network can provide independently verified location data to help drones stay within approved flight paths, avoid collisions with moving and stationary objects, and report package locations at critical points. The trustless location verification provided by "XYO Network" can eliminate this requirement, making the overall process and user experience for customers smoother. The incorporation of the XYO Network's unique blockchain technology will maximize the efficiency of the implemented drone systems, which is a must for any newly formed industry to thrive.
